基于C#和SharpPcap实现的sniffer
程序员文章站
2022-05-30 11:56:10
...
网络攻防课下写了一个Windows平台上的网络嗅探器,能显示所捕获的数据包并能做相应的分析和统计。
主要功能如下:
1. 列出监测主机的所有网卡,选择一个网卡,可以设置为混杂模式进行监听,也 可以设为普通模式进行监听。
2. 捕获所有流经网卡的数据包,并利用SharpPcap函数库设置过滤规则。
3. 分析捕获到的数据包的包头和数据,按照各种协议的格式进行格式化显示。
其他功能和源代码参照使用手册和程序~